  • What began as a mining camp in the mid 1800's grew into the thriving city that is Georgetown. The city features a Historical Landmark District and an array of recreational activities. Locals and tourists enjoy fishing in Clear Creek, riding the Georgetown Loop Railroad or taking in the scenic views of the surrounding Rocky Mountains.

Golf 259 County Road 5, Leadville, CO 80461 MoreLess Info
At an elevation of 9,860 feet, Mount Massive Golf Club is the highest golf course in the nation. Surrounded by the Rockies, golfers of all skill levels enjoy the scenery and the course while facilities are also available for private events.

National & State Parks 1000 Hwy 36, Estes Park, CO 80517 MoreLess Info
Spanning 415 square miles, Rocky Mountain National Park offers unique and stunning mountain scenery. The park features extensive networks of trails that lead to remarkable vistas. Visitors can also sled, snowshoe, or camp.
